September Courtney

July 28, 1965 – July 8, 2026

September Courtney, age 60, of Florissant, Missouri, passed away peacefully at home on July 8, 2026, after a brave battle with cancer.

Born in St. Louis on July 28, 1965, September was the daughter of the late David and Joanne Courtney. She grew up to become the kindest, most big-hearted person to those who knew her. Though she was naturally quiet around new people, once you got to know her, she was a fiercely loyal friend for life. September was deeply protective of everyone she loved and would truly help anyone in need.

A life-long, die-hard St. Louis Cardinals fan, September also had a great love for soccer. Her passions extended to photography, reading, talking politics, and a deep affection for animals. Above all else, she loved her family.

She is survived by her devoted husband, Joseph Little; her sisters, Danielle Courtney and Christine Courtney; her brother, William Courtney; her sister-in-law, Charlotte Miller; her brother-in-law, Ben Miller; and many cherished nieces, nephews, aunts, uncles, and friends. She was preceded in death by her beloved parents, David and Joanne Courtney.

Celebration of Life

A celebration of September’s life will be held at a later date, with details to be announced. Instead of mourning her passing, the family invites you to join them in celebrating the beautiful life she lived.

Memorial Contributions

In lieu of flowers, memorial contributions may be made in September’s honor to the American Cancer Society.
